Terms & Conditions
- Google and its partners ( organizers) award this scholarship based on the overall strength of the candidates’ application.
- Upon selection, notifications will be sent to the applicants, and they will not dispute the same at any point in time as the selection is full and final.
- The Venkat Panchapakesan Memorial Scholarship award of $2,500 USD must be spent on tuition, fees, books, supplies and equipment required for the student’s classes at their primary university.
- Tax liability, if any, in relation to this scholarship award will have to be borne by the scholarship recipient.
- Scholarship recipients must be enrolled as full-time students for the academic years of the scholarship. Enrollment will be verified after the winners are selected, and all scholarship payments will be made directly to the student to be used towards tuition and education-related expenses.
- We will withhold the award for any scholar who no longer meets the eligibility requirements and revoke the award for any scholar who does not maintain the eligibility requirements.
- Any employee of Google Inc. including its affiliates and subsidiaries is not eligible to apply for Google scholarships.
- Persons who are (1) residents of embargoed countries, (2) ordinarily resident in embargoed countries, or (3) otherwise prohibited by applicable export controls and sanctions programs may not apply for this scholars.

When do I submit the recommendation letter for the Venkat Scholarship?
Students who are applying for the program do not need to submit a letter of recommendation unless they are selected.
For candidates who have been selected for the Venkat scholarship award, the letter of recommendation can come from your faculty or supervisor at the workplace.
According to Build Your Future with Google, a workplace for this essence can include but is not limited to an internship workplace, a part-time workplace and others like the full-time workplace.
Academically and for students who could not get their letter of recommendation from their university, Google expressly stated that anyone can issue this letter for the candidate.
However, the person writing the letter of recommendation must know the scholarship candidate very well and be able to establish that in the writing.
Who is Venkat Panchapakesan?
Venkat Panchapakesan of Indian descent was a Google VP and Engineer who led engineering for YouTube.
He died at an early age after a battle with Cancer. Venkat spent more than ten (10) years at Yahoo, where he worked on several products and spent time leading a research and development centre in his native India.
